Well, I enjoyed that episode, but it seems like I’m in the
minority. But then as I get older, I tend to prefer quiet, gentle
short stories more than big, long epics, so it’s not surprising
I welcomed a breather episode as a nice change from all
the action.

And, as I’ve said before, Chibnall’s small-scale character
sketches are much better than his attempts at plots.

It was good to learn more about Vinder’s background
at
long last. My only complaint is that he wasn’t atoning for
a serious crime, which would’ve given him some interesting
moral complexity. Instead he really is a genuinely good
guy who did nothing wrong and has a devoted, loving woman
looking for him. (It was also kind of obvious that he would
turn out to be who she was looking for. Why else introduce
her in the episode that gives his backstory?)

It was also great to see the past connection between Swarm
and the Doctor. I didn’t care for the look of old Swarm
though. His appearance has definitely improved with age!

Talking of changed appearances, it was a pity we couldn’t
see more of Jo Martin’s pre-Hartnell Doctor, but I loved
the brief glimpses we got. (Could COVID restrictions be
they couldn’t actually show her with any other people?)

Maybe those restrictions are also why this episode had
so few guest actors, with the regulars doubling up in multiple
roles. Whatever the reason it added a wonderful surreal
atmosphere to the episode, like no other. Of the few guests
there were, it was interesting to see Dot from Line Of Duty
playing an equally corrupt character. He’s probably typecast
for life! (I’m a bit confused though about why Vinder was
so shocked to learn that someone literally called the Great
Serpent wasn’t entirely trustworthy!)

For me, the weakest parts of the episode were those that
were only there to tie into the wider epic. Why is a Weeping
Angel stalking Yaz? Is the mysterious old woman the White
Guardian or a future Doctor? Who started the Flux? And
what else does Karvanista know that he isn’t telling?

So onto my thoughts.

Structurally this is clear it is an epsiode that isn't a straight-
forward episode in terms of introduce threat or monster and deal
with it. It simultaneously introduces Bel and expands Vinder's
backstory so we know what has gone on that resulted in the shit
posting he had in episode 1. Through Bel's story we see Daleks and
Cybermen taking advantage of the Flux - so that is three time capable
races all trying to carve out their individual sectors. This was very
deftly done without requiring a Dalek and a Cyberman episode. We
also got to see how Swarm was defeated way back (although we don't
know who two of the Doctor's companions were at that point, although
we know one is a Lupari). We get hints of Weeping Angels for the
cliff-hanger and we know that they will return for their episode.
One interesting thing is that the Angels seem to be able to travel
from electronic device to reality - I don't think we have seen that
before.

Finally we are also introduced to Awsok (the shady old lady played
by Barbara Flynn) who may well be ultimately pulling the strings.
She didn't seem to be a very sympathetic figure.

If you haven't realised by now I liked this episode a lot and it
is some of the best story-telling we have seen for a long time.
Unfortunately I think the effects are uneven - some are really good
but at other times the CGI and matte work looks a little obvious.
